A Captivating Storyline and Engaging Characters

The Book of Mormon tells the story of two young Mormon missionaries, Elder Price and Elder Cunningham, who are sent to Uganda to spread the teachings of their faith. However, they soon discover that their mission is far from what they expected. The musical cleverly blends humor and satire to explore themes of religion, culture clash, and personal growth.

Controversy and Critical Reception

The Book of Mormon has not been without controversy. Its irreverent take on religion and its explicit language have drawn criticism from some religious groups. However, the musical has also received widespread acclaim and multiple awards, including nine Tony Awards and a Grammy Award for Best Musical Theater Album. Its ability to provoke discussion and challenge societal norms has contributed to its success.

1. What is The Book of Mormon?

The Book of Mormon is a sacred text in the Latter-day Saint movement, which includes The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ints (LDS Church). It is believed to be a record of ancient prophets who lived on the American continent and contains teachings and stories about Jesus Christ.

2. Is The Book of Mormon a musical?

Yes, The Book of Mormon is a highly popular and critically acclaimed Broadway musical. It was created by Trey Parker, Robert Lopez, and Matt Stone, the same team behind the television show South Park. The musical humorously tells the story of two young Mormon missionaries who are sent to a remote village in Uganda.

4. Is The Book of Mormon appropriate for all audiences?

The Book of Mormon contains explicit language and tackles sensitive topics, so it may not be suitable for all audiences, particularly young children. The musical is known for its satirical and irreverent humor, which some people find hilarious while others may find offensive. It is recommended that you research the content and decide if it aligns with your personal preferences and sensitivities before attending.

5. How long is The Book of Mormon musical?

The Book of Mormon has a running time of approximately 2 hours and 30 minutes, including one intermission. The exact duration may vary slightly depending on the production and any potential changes made to the show.

6. Is The Book of Mormon a religious recruitment tool?

No, The Book of Mormon musical is not intended as a religious recruitment tool. While it does feature characters who are Mormon missionaries, the musical primarily aims to entertain and satirize various aspects of organized religion and missionary work. It is important to differentiate between the musical's content and the beliefs and practices of the actual LDS Church.
